CameraService: Disable overrideToPortrait for dumpsys media.camera.
Also upgrade logging for the sensor orientation override to info,
and add a log for when the device orientation map is erased. This
is required for debugging purposes.
Bug: 264647891
Test: Ran adb shell dumpsys media.camera.
